State-Sovereignty-vs-International-Obligations.
This document explores the relationship between state sovereignty and international obligations in the modern global system. It examines how states attempt to protect their independence, territorial integrity, and decision-making authority while also fulfilling responsibilities under international law, treaties, and global organizations. The paper discusses the tension between national interests and international cooperation, especially in areas such as human rights, security, humanitarian intervention, and global governance. The document analyzes different theoretical perspectives including realism, liberalism, and constructivism to explain how states respond to international pressure and global norms. It also highlights the role of organizations such as the United Nations in influencing state behavior and maintaining international order.
